Ljoy Automatic Control Equipment
Email:lujing@ljoy1206.com

Two-Axis Motion Controller PLC

The two-axis motion controller PLC is a key component of industrial automation systems, providing precise control of linear and rotary axes. This device performs complex calculations to ensure accurate positioning, velocity control, and acceleration/deceleration profiles. The PLC also monitors feedback signals from encoders or sensors to maintain consistent performance and safety standards. Additionally, it facilitates the integration of various motion control functions, such as profiling, sync control, and axis grouping, into a single, coordinated system. This ensures efficient automation of manufacturing processes, maximizing productivity and profitability while minimizing errors and downtime.

In the modern industrial automation landscape, the role of Programmable Logic Controllers (PLCs) in coordinating and controlling complex machinery is pivotal. PLCs are computer-based systems that interface with various industrial inputs and outputs, processing data at high speeds and making quick, logical decisions to ensure efficient and safe operation of industrial processes. In the context of two-axis motion control, PLCs play a crucial role in coordinating and controlling the motion of two or more axes simultaneously.

Two-axis motion control is a specialized field that involves the precise coordination of two degrees of freedom (DOFs) in space. This can be found in applications such as robotics, machine tools, and automated manufacturing systems, where the precise and synchronized movement of multiple axes is essential for accurate and efficient operation. PLCs are able to handle this task by receiving input signals from encoders, sensors, and other feedback devices, processing this data, and then sending out control signals to drive motors, actuators, and other output devices.

In terms of functionality, PLCs for two-axis motion control must be able to handle complex algorithms and data processing tasks. This includes tasks such as interpolation, which involves the calculation of intermediate points between two known points on a curve, and profiling, which refers to the creation of optimized motion profiles that minimize cycle time while maximizing accuracy. PLCs must also handle tasks like collision detection and resolution, as well as path planning and kinematics calculations.

Collision detection is an important safety feature that ensures two or more axes do not come into physical contact with each other, potentially causing damage or injury. PLCs are able to perform these calculations in real time, providing quick and accurate responses to ensure safe operation. Path planning involves determining the optimal sequence of moves for multiple axes to follow, while kinematics calculations determine the relationship between the positions of different axes.

In addition to these complex calculations, PLCs also handle tasks like speed control, acceleration and deceleration profiles, and synchronization of multiple axes. For example, in a machine tool application, PLCs can be used to precisely control the feed rate of a tool along its path, while simultaneously controlling the rotation speed of a spindle motor. This ensures that the tool is moving at the right speed and direction at all times, maximizing efficiency and minimizing wear on the tool.

Communication between PLCs and other devices in the system is essential for effective two-axis motion control. PLCs are able to receive feedback signals from encoders or sensors on each axis, allowing them to make adjustments to ensure accurate positioning. They are also able to send control signals to drivers or actuators for each axis, coordinating their movement precisely. This communication is often done through digital or analog signals, with common communication protocols like Profinet, EtherNet/IP, or Modbus being used.

Overall, PLCs play a crucial role in two-axis motion control by receiving input signals, processing data, making logical decisions, and sending out control signals to ensure efficient and safe operation of industrial processes. With their ability to handle complex calculations and coordinate multiple axes simultaneously, PLCs are essential for modern industrial automation systems.

Articles related to the knowledge points of this article:

Controller PLC Demand Analysis

PLC Controller Programming: What It Is and How It Works

PLC Controller Point Count Location

PLC Oil Pump Controller Fault Analysis

PLC Controllers in Wuhan Tunnels

Electro-cylindrical Controller and PLC: A Comprehensive Guide